Excellent idea - a great way to spend a couple of hours with the kids getting to drive the boat in the safety of the open water - weather typically Scottish so take a jacket and admire the views and the freedom of the loch - went for 2 hours but 3 would be better to allow time to explore the islands in loch as it takes over 40 minutes to get there from the base. Welcome and instructions all perfectly good - better map of how to get to the base would help - if you are at the large building near the loch (at Loch Lomond Shores retail part) it is towards the large boat - follow boat hire signs - wouldn't take very young kids but 5+yrs should be fine for a great adventure and experience

The Ardlui Marina lies on the tranquil north shores of Loch Lomond. With all the facilities you expect from a premiere marina, the Ardlui Marina boasts swinging moorings, floating pontoons and an out of the water boat yard among its many attributes. Other facilities include a twenty ton travel hoist, a slipway, trailer and boat storage, hull maintenance, floating fuel pontoon, pump out station, boat hire, and ferry from the West Highland Way. Our recently re-furbished floating pier is available for visitors wishing to come for a short visit or even stay a night or two.  With fresh water and electric hook-up you’ll have everything you need during your visit to the north of the loch.  And of course the facilities of the hotel bar and restaurant are only a short walk away.

Ardlui Holiday Home Park Aerial1

SWINGING MOORINGS

The sheltered bay at Ardlui is home to 26 swinging moorings taking boats up to 35′ or 15 tonnes.  Great for people looking to keep their boat on the loch at an affordable price.   The front of our pier can be used to load and unload goods onto your boat to make things easy.

Marina2

Our twenty ton travel hoist is on-hand to launch or recover your boat for either yard works or transportation to and from the loch.  

If your looking to do a bit of work on your hull or stern drives we can lift you out into our boat yard and pop you back in when ready.  If its a quick job, we can hold you on the slings for anything from an hour to a day or two!

Loch Cruises

No trip to Loch Lomond & The Trossachs National Park would be complete without a cruise across a loch. Sit back, relax and take in the beautiful and dramatic scenery. On Loch Lomond, opportunities to cruise the loch are available from Balloch (on the River Leven just opposite the railway station or from Loch Lomond Shores, and from Tarbet, Inversnaid, Luss and Rowardennan.

For trips on Loch Katrine  cruises run from Trossachs Pier near Aberfoyle, to Stronachlachar and back. Choose from circular cruises, or a number of themed journeys like sunset, island discovery, wildlife and history.

There’s also a short ferry from Balmaha to Inchcailloch  – a nature reserve with shady woodland walks, sandy beaches, wildlife and a history of saints and early Christianity. And speed boat trips if you fancied something faster, available from Luss Pier.

lomond-duchess-boat-on-loch

As well as the cruises, there’s a scheduled waterbus service providing regular ferry services between both shores of Loch Lomond at numerous disembarkation points – Inveruglas, Inversnaid, Tarbet, Rowardennan, Luss, Balmaha, and Balloch.

These services have been designed to provide visitors with the flexibility of combining trips on the loch, with breaks on shore – for lunch stops, picnics, pub visits, short (and long) walks, cycle routes (bring your bike or rent one locally), exploring local history (Rob Roy in particular) and wildlife, even bagging a Munro – or to tie-in with train stations (Balloch and Tarbet).

The waterbus service even stretches across two lochs – combining Lochs Lomond and Katrine, linking Tarbet and Trossachs Pier via Inversnaid and Stronachlachar – mind you’ll need to walk or cycle the 5 miles between the two lochs, twice!

If you fancy being captain of your own vessel, then why not hire a boat? Self-drive rentals are available from the lagoon at Loch Lomond Shores, while you can hire a speed boat complete with driver/guide at Luss Pier. Or power your own with row boats at Balmaha and canoes at Loch Lomond Shores.

Cheap car hire at Moscow Vnukovo airport

Top tips for hiring a car at moscow vnukovo airport.

  • Whether you’re visiting Moscow for a week or a month, getting a car rental at Moscow Vnukovo Airport (VKO) is the best way to explore the Russian capital. You’ll traverse various parts of the city that aren’t fully accessible by public transport. Self-driving lets you choose the shortest route to your destination and avoid traffic. Renting a car will save you money compared to using a taxi when you look at the overall costs to multiple destinations.
  • Collecting your rental car at Moscow Vnukovo Airport isn’t that complicated. You’ll find several local and international car rental suppliers at the airport with an on-site counter. Car rental desks at VKO are on the ground level in the Arrivals section, Terminal A. Once you get to the airport, head straight to your preferred company’s rental desk. You can also visit the rental desks after booking online. Make sure you carry all the requested documents. After processing, a staff member from the rental company will guide you to the pick-up point outside the terminal. Take your time to inspect the car for any dents or damages. Check the fuel level and make sure your maps are working and in your preferred language since most road signs in Moscow are in Russian.
  • The other benefit of getting a car rental at Moscow Vnukovo Airport is that you’ll have a smooth return process. Most rental companies will ask you to return the rental car to the exact location you collected it, or the drop-off point stated in your rental contract. What you should pay attention to is the return period. Make sure you return the car on time to avoid the late return penalty fee. You can inform the company early if you’re facing challenges and can’t return the rental car on time. After dropping off the vehicle, conduct a final inspection to check for damages before heading to your rental counter for clearance.
  • Moscow Vnukovo Airport usually gets busy between March to July when most tourists visit for the summer holidays. During this period, car rental bookings are generally high. You can experience long waits at the car rental counter. The airport also gets busy during weekends, special events, holidays, and major conferences in Moscow. We advise you to book in advance for availability and to save money since rates are comparatively pricey during the peak travel season.
  • Book your car hire at Moscow Vnukovo airport at least 4 weeks before your trip in order to get a below-average price

FAQs about hiring a car at Moscow Vnukovo airport

What documents do i need to rent a car at moscow vnukovo airport.

To rent a car at Moscow Vnukovo Airport, you will need a valid driver’s license from your home country that has been valid for at least one year. You should provide an International Driving Permit for translation purposes. Most companies will also require your passport for additional proof of identity. A valid credit card with enough cash for deposit and payment must also be presented. Some companies will ask you to bring a printout of the booking confirmation voucher sent to your mail.

What amenities are available at Moscow Vnukovo Airport?

You’ll have access to several amenities when you opt for a car rental at Moscow Vnukovo Airport, including showers in various lounges, ATMs, luggage carts, and free Wi-Fi. If you’re traveling with children, you can take advantage of the children’s playroom in Terminal A. There is a parenting room equipped with changing tables, baby cribs, and play areas for parents traveling with newborns. VKO is perfectly equipped for passengers with reduced mobility.

How can I pay for my Moscow Vnukovo Airport car rental?

The best way to pay for your Moscow Vnukovo Airport car rental is using a major credit card. It is a secure option for renters and the best security for rental companies during your rental period. Few car rental suppliers may let you pay using a debit card but with several limitations and requirements. They will restrict you to certain types of rental cars, and you may be asked to produce additional proof of identity or your return travel details.

Which car hire companies will pick you up at Moscow Vnukovo airport?

Car hire companies that offer shuttle or pick-up services from Moscow Vnukovo airport to off-airport locations include Avis, Rentmotors, Sixt, and TIS Car.

SPEEDBOAT TRIP ON LOCH LOMOND

The 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 is the most basic trip that we offer.

The 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 is aimed at persons who have a limited budget or time restrictions.

The 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 will last for 20 minutes and depart from Luss Pier at regular intervals.

The maximum seating capacity is 10 passengers per boat [11 persons including our driver].

All passengers will be asked to wait until the boat fills up and small groups will be mixed together.

The price for the 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 is noted below:

*In the unlikely event that a boat does not fill up then a minimum charge of £60 is applicable [£60 per boat].

OPENING TIMES

The 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 is available 7 days per week during summer months [subject to availability].

The ‘Short Speedboat Trip’ is NOT available in winter.

Victor M. Mukhin was born in 1946 in the town of Orsk, Russia. In 1970 he graduated the Technological Institute in Leningrad. Victor M. Mukhin was directed to work to the scientific-industrial organization "Neorganika" (Elektrostal, Moscow region) where he is working during 47 years, at present as the head of the laboratory of carbon sorbents.     Victor M. Mukhin defended a Ph. D. thesis and a doctoral thesis at the Mendeleev University of Chemical Technology of Russia (in 1979 and 1997 accordingly). Professor of Mendeleev University of Chemical Technology of Russia. Scientific interests: production, investigation and application of active carbons, technological and ecological carbon-adsorptive processes, environmental protection, production of ecologically clean food.
